An active condition must be in play or established when the action requiring it is
declared. Active conditions serve as the price of an action. They are restrictions on the
player invoking the action.
Annotation 5: If an action requires an entity to tap as a condition for the action's main
effect, that entity must be untapped when the action is declared; else, the action may
not be declared. Tap the entity at this point; this is considered synonymous with the
action's declaration, i.e., it is not a separate action. When it comes time to resolve the
action in its chain of effects, that entity must still be in play and tapped or the action is
canceled.
Annotation 6: If an action requires an entity to be discarded as a condition for the
action's main effect, that entity must be discarded when the action is declared; this is
considered synonymous with the action's declaration, i.e., it is not a separate action.
Annotation 7: If any other active condition for an action does not exist when the
action is resolved, the action has no effect; if the action was playing a card from your
hand, it is discarded.
Annotation 8: An action that requires a target is considered to have the active
condition that the target be in play when the action is declared and when it is resolved.
An action may not be declared if its target is not in play. However, dice-rolling actions
may always be targeted by other actions declared later in the same chain of effects.
